1881: New South Wales Protector of Aborigines – Aboriginals forced to live on reserves with no legal rights and condemned to poverty. Between 1915 and 1939 any station manager or policeman could take children from their parents.

Aboriginal Day of Mourning, led by leading activist, William Cooper.

1909 NSW Aborigines Protection Act: 1: Control of money for assisting Aborigines 2: Distribute blankets and clothing to Aborigines 3: Have custody of Aboriginal children and educate them 4: Manage reserves 5: Supervise all matter affecting Aborigines 6: Remove from the reserve any Aborigines who should be earning their own living.

In New South Wales alone more than children were taken from their families. White authorities went to great lengths to break the cultural and family bonds between parents and children. In 1921 a Northern Territory Aboriginal children’s home housed 52 children in three iron sheds behind the local hotel. At the age of 14 most children left the mission of government institution. Education for aboriginal children viewed as futile.

The United Nations Convention of 1948 defines genocide as any of the following acts committed with the intent to destroy, in whole or in part, a national, ethnic, racial or religious group: (a) Killing members of the group; (b) Causing serious bodily or mental harm to members of the group; (c) Deliberately inflicting on the group conditions of life calculated to bring about its physical destruction in whole or in part; (d) Imposing measures intended to prevent births within the group; (e) Forcibly transferring children of the group to another group.
